    I don't remember what strength I used, but it was pretty easy, much easier with two people.
    The headliner was about $40-$50 if I recall of Amazon.
    You could watch a guide off youtube.
    Remember not to spray too much or it will bleed through, and do it in segments.
    After you do one part, just smooth it down, it is like an easier process of vinyl wrapping.
